Output d0b5e688aef33d11c076394ba366158dfd2b45cbfe80c601fe52028c4bde8dcd:1

value
18010597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a993ed7ae80ff3010a047a9623f35b65fdea1fc OP_EQUAL
address
39x4KVS11yQdMDmBVLQLnpmVzF9kBU2XHE
transaction
d0b5e688aef33d11c076394ba366158dfd2b45cbfe80c601fe52028c4bde8dcd
confirmations
359896
spent
true